Her mother passed away only days before she had to compete in the 2010 olympic games. She ended up winning Bronze
Mark Grimmette. Grimmette, a luger, won a bronze medal at the 1998 Winter Games in Nagano in men's doubles and a silver medal at the 2002 Winter Games in Salt Lake City in men's doubles (both with partner Brian Martin). The 2010 Winter Games will be his 5th Olympics.
